Understanding the Foundation of Classic Car Restoration

Before you turn a single wrench, it’s vital to understand the scope of your project. Classic car restoration can range from minor cosmetic touch-ups to full frame-off rebuilds. Assess your vehicle’s condition and set clear goals. Are you aiming for a factory-fresh look, or do you have a custom vision in mind? This initial assessment will guide your entire project.

Next, consider the workspace. A well-organized garage with ample lighting and the right tools is paramount. The satisfaction of restoration doesn’t just come from the finished product but from the process itself. Make sure you have a comfortable and safe environment to work in. Every classic car has its story, and part of restoration is preserving that narrative. Whether it’s a family heirloom or a barn find, do your research. Understanding the vehicle’s history can inform your restoration process and help you maintain authenticity.

Finding the Right Tools for the Job

The proper tools are the restorer’s best friends. Invest in quality tools that will last and consider the specific needs of your project. Sandblasting is excellent for stripping large, heavy parts, but an orbital disc sander might be better for finer work. Don’t underestimate the value of specialized tools. They can make all the difference in achieving professional results. For example, a high-quality torque wrench is crucial for engine work, ensuring that bolts are tightened to the correct specifications. Our tool reviews can help you make the right choices.

Sourcing parts can be a challenge, particularly for rare models. Establish a network of suppliers and fellow enthusiasts early on. Online marketplaces, classic car shows, and restoration forums are invaluable resources for finding those elusive parts.

Restoration Techniques to Bring Your Classic Car to Life

Bodywork and paint are often the most visible aspects of a restoration. Achieving a flawless finish requires patience and skill. Start with a solid metalwork foundation—repair or replace any rusted sections, and ensure panel gaps are even. Primer is your ally in the battle against imperfections, creating a smooth surface for the final paint.

When it comes to the engine, a balance of performance and authenticity is key. You might want to rebuild the original engine to keep it numbers-matching or upgrade components for better reliability and power. Whatever path you choose, make sure to document the process. Photos and detailed records can be helpful for future maintenance or if you decide to sell the vehicle.

The interior of your classic car is where comfort meets style. Upholstery, carpeting, and trim pieces should be restored or replaced to match the era of the vehicle. Customization here can add a personal touch while still respecting the car’s heritage.
